.NET 8 一个插件化、多协议的跨平台远程管理系统

.NET 8 一个插件化、多协议的跨平台远程管理系统

💡 原文中文,约1800字,阅读约需5分钟。
📝

内容提要

AVAS是一款基于C#和.NET 8.0开发的现代化远程管理系统,支持多种网络协议和插件架构,具备多人协作能力。该系统采用C2架构,完全开源,适用于Windows、Linux和macOS,提供灵活、隐蔽的远程管理体验,满足复杂网络环境的需求。

🎯

关键要点

  • AVAS是一款基于C#和.NET 8.0开发的现代化远程管理系统。

  • 支持多种网络协议和插件架构,具备多人协作能力。

  • 采用C2架构,由服务端、客户端界面和被控端代理三部分组成。

  • 系统完全开源,适用于Windows、Linux和macOS。

  • 提供灵活、隐蔽的远程管理体验,满足复杂网络环境的需求。

  • 支持TCP、UDP、WebSocket、HTTP/HTTPS、ICMP、DHCP、SMB等7种协议。

  • 服务端可同时运行多个不同类型的监听器,支持动态管理。

  • 允许多个操作员同时连接到同一服务端,实现团队协同作业。

  • 内置核心插件,开发者可轻松编写新插件集成。

  • 客户端基于Avalonia构建,界面简洁流畅,支持高DPI显示。

  • AVAS结合灵活性与隐蔽性,能在严格防火墙环境中有效工作。

  • 所有通信默认启用加密认证,保障操作安全。

  • 项目结构清晰,模块职责分明,便于维护和扩展。

  • 项目填补了传统工具在灵活性和用户体验上的空白。

🔎

延伸解读

灵活性与隐蔽性的优势

AVAS系统的设计充分考虑了在复杂网络环境中的应用需求。它支持多种网络协议,包括一些非常规通道,如ICMP和DHCP,这使得在严格防火墙环境中仍能有效工作。这种灵活性不仅提升了连接成功率,也增强了隐蔽性,适合渗透测试和红队演练等场景。

插件化架构的扩展性

AVAS的插件化架构使得功能扩展变得简单,开发者只需实现标准接口即可集成新插件。这种设计不仅提高了系统的可定制性,还能快速响应用户需求,适应不同的使用场景。内置的核心插件如远程桌面和文件管理,进一步增强了系统的实用性。

团队协作的实时性

AVAS允许多个操作员同时连接到同一服务端,实时同步会话状态。这种多人协作能力在团队作业中极为重要,能够提升工作效率,确保信息的即时共享和操作的协调。尤其在紧急情况下,快速响应和协同作业能够显著提高任务完成的成功率。

延伸问答

AVAS系统的主要功能是什么?

AVAS系统支持多协议通信、多监听器管理、多人协作和插件化功能扩展。

AVAS是基于什么技术开发的?

AVAS是基于C#和.NET 8.0开发的,使用Avalonia框架实现跨平台图形界面。

AVAS如何支持多人协作?

AVAS允许多个操作员同时连接到同一服务端,实时同步会话状态,实现团队协同作业。

AVAS支持哪些网络协议?

AVAS支持TCP、UDP、WebSocket、HTTP/HTTPS、ICMP、DHCP、SMB等7种协议。

AVAS的安全性如何保障?

AVAS所有通信默认启用加密认证,避免明文传输敏感指令,保障操作安全。

AVAS的插件机制是怎样的?

AVAS内置核心插件,开发者可轻松编写新插件集成,只需实现标准接口即可。

🏷️

标签

➡️

继续阅读